Web hosting and server administration
Published on May 11, 2024
In the world of web hosting, server backup strategies are essential for protecting valuable data and ensuring business continuity. In this article, we will explore the concept of server backup strategies and the different backup types, such as full, incremental, and differential backups, used in web hosting.
Server backup strategies involve the process of creating and storing copies of data to protect against data loss. These strategies are critical for businesses that rely on their online presence and need to safeguard their website and customer data.
A full backup involves creating a complete copy of all data in a system. This type of backup provides a comprehensive snapshot of the entire server at a specific point in time. While full backups offer the most complete protection, they can be time-consuming and require significant storage space.
Incremental backups only save the data that has changed since the last backup, whether it is a full backup or an incremental backup. This approach reduces the time and storage space required for backups, making it an efficient option for businesses with large amounts of data.
Differential backups save all the data that has changed since the last full backup. While they require more storage space than incremental backups, they are faster to restore, making them a good compromise between full and incremental backups.
Full backups offer the advantage of complete data protection. In the event of data loss, a full backup can restore the entire system to its previous state, minimizing downtime and potential data loss.
Incremental backups only save the data that has changed since the last backup, while full backups create a complete copy of all data. This key difference influences the time and storage requirements for each type of backup.
Differential backups require more storage space than incremental backups, and they can take longer to create. Additionally, restoring from a differential backup may take longer than restoring from an incremental backup.
When implementing server backup strategies, it is important to establish a regular backup schedule, test backups regularly to ensure data integrity, and store backups in a secure offsite location. Utilizing a combination of full, incremental, and differential backups can provide comprehensive data protection.
There are several reliable backup solutions available for web hosting, including cloud-based backup services, dedicated backup servers, and backup software with built-in scheduling and automation features. It is essential to choose a backup solution that meets the specific needs of the business and provides reliable data protection.
In conclusion, server backup strategies are critical for businesses that rely on their online presence. Understanding the different types of backups, such as full, incremental, and differential backups, and implementing best practices for backup strategies can help businesses protect their valuable data and ensure business continuity in the event of data loss.
Server security is a critical aspect of web hosting, as it involves protecting the server and the data it holds from various threats and vulnerabilities. In this article, we will discuss the concept of server security and the measures taken to protect web hosting environments from potential risks.
Server Virtualization Technologies in Web Hosting: Types and Benefits
Server administration is a critical aspect of managing a web hosting environment. It involves a range of responsibilities and concepts that are essential for ensuring the smooth operation and performance of servers.
In today's digital world, website performance is crucial for attracting and retaining visitors. One of the key factors that can significantly impact website performance is server caching. Understanding server caching and its impact on website performance in a web hosting environment is essential for web administrators and developers.
Implementing High Availability and Failover Mechanisms in Web Hosting
Domain Registration and Web Hosting: A Comprehensive Guide
In today's digital age, having a strong online presence is essential for businesses and individuals alike. One of the first steps to establishing this presence is registering a domain and finding a reliable web hosting service. This comprehensive guide will walk you through the process of domain registration, its connection with web hosting, the importance of server administration, and the impact of software in technology.
In today's fast-paced digital world, web hosting is a critical component of any online business or organization. With the increasing reliance on websites and web applications, the performance and reliability of web hosting servers are of utmost importance. To ensure optimal performance and usage analysis, implementing server-level monitoring and reporting mechanisms is essential. This article will discuss the considerations for implementing server-level monitoring and reporting mechanisms, such as real-time performance monitoring and historical usage analysis, in a web hosting environment.
Before delving into the considerations and best practices, it is important to understand what SSL certificates are and their role in web hosting. SSL certificates are small data files that digitally bind a cryptographic key to an organization's details. When installed on a web server, they activate the padlock and the https protocol, allowing secure connections from a web server to a browser. This ensures that all data passed between the web server and browsers remain private and integral.
Web hosting, on the other hand, refers to the service that allows organizations and individuals to post a website or web page onto the Internet. When it comes to implementing SSL certificates in a web hosting environment, there are several important considerations to take into account.
The benefits of using SSL certificates in web hosting are numerous. Firstly, SSL certificates provide data encryption, which ensures that information remains secure from potential cyber threats. This is particularly crucial for websites that handle sensitive data such as personal information, credit card details, and login credentials. Additionally, SSL certificates help in building trust with website visitors, as they can see the padlock icon in the address bar, signifying a secure connection.
Moreover, SSL certificates are also known to improve search engine rankings, as major search engines like Google prioritize websites with HTTPS over those with HTTP. This can lead to increased visibility and traffic for websites, ultimately benefiting the overall online presence.
Before implementing server-level security measures, it is essential to assess the specific security needs of the web hosting environment. This includes understanding the types of data and applications being hosted, as well as the potential threats and vulnerabilities.
Additionally, it is important to consider the performance impact of the security measures on the server. Finding the right balance between security and performance is key to ensuring that the server operates efficiently while being adequately protected.
There are several common types of firewalls used in web hosting environments, including packet filtering firewalls, stateful inspection firewalls, and application-level gateways. Each type of firewall has its own strengths and weaknesses, and the choice of firewall depends on the specific security requirements of the web hosting environment.
Packet filtering firewalls, for example, examine the headers of data packets to determine whether to allow or block them. Stateful inspection firewalls, on the other hand, keep track of the state of active connections and make decisions based on the context of the traffic. Application-level gateways, also known as proxy firewalls, provide a higher level of security by inspecting the content of the data packets.
When it comes to choosing a web hosting provider for your specific website, there are several important factors to take into consideration. Your web hosting provider plays a crucial role in the performance, security, and scalability of your website, so it's essential to choose wisely.
One of the first factors to consider is the type of web hosting that best suits your website's needs. There are several types of web hosting available, including shared hosting, VPS hosting, dedicated hosting, and cloud hosting. Each type has its own advantages and limitations, so it's important to understand the differences and choose the one that aligns with your website's requirements.
The physical location of the web hosting server can have a significant impact on your website's performance. The closer the server is to your target audience, the faster the loading times will be. This is particularly important for websites that target a specific geographic location, as it can improve user experience and SEO rankings.